The Gould solenoid general purpose valve KRX-3T-2 with cast 316 Stainless Steel CF8M body, 2-way, Velvetrol® Internal Piston Pilot Operated, full port, with 5-150 PSI for Air, Inert Gases, Water, Aqueous Liquids, Oils (400SSU or 30SAE) and Corrosive Fluids.
The valve is normally open, requires a minimum 5 PSI differential pressure. Features Explosion Proof Coil Housing – meets Class 1 Div 2, Class 1 Group D, Class 2 Group E, F, G NEMA 7 Explosion Proof. Also meets NEMA 4 Watertight/Corrosive Resistant & NEMA 5 Dusttight.corrosive resistant. Molded of filled polyester with 18” leads and ½” conduit connector. Available with Teflon Seats.
The Gould KRX-3T Fluid temperature range is –40°F to +300ºF.
The KRX-3T solenoid valve Standard coil voltages are available in (AC) 24, 120, 240, 480 (60hz) 26 Watts Max. (DC) 12V, 24V, 48V, 115V and 230V, 26 Watts Max.
Available in sizes ranging from 1/8" to 2" NPT threaded.

Installation: Install in HORIZONTAL pipe with COIL ASSEMBLY on TOP AND VERTICAL with FLOW ARROW or IN AND OUT markings in the proper direction. ALL PIPING should be blown clear before installation, and a 40 mesh STRAINER should be installed ahead of the valve. STEAM LINES should be properly TRAPPED at the valve inlet. PIPE DOPE is NOT recommended, but if used, should not be applied to the VALVE BODY. Apply sparingly to the pipe threads only. J.D. Gould Company recommends Teflon™ tape for all connections. PIPING should be properly aligned and supported to avoid strain on the valve body. The VALVE BODY should not be held in a VISE except across the pipe ends. Use a PIPE VISE or WRENCH on the pipe and a WRENCH on the HEX PIPE ENDS. DO NOT use the COIL ASSEMBLY for a LEVER to tighten piping.
Maintenance: Close the supply SHUT OFF VALVE and ENERGIZE the SOLENOID VALVE to de-pressurize the inlet supply line. DISCONNECT ELECTRICAL POWER before removing the COIL ASSEMBLY. The COIL will overheat and burn out if left ENERGIZED without the entire SOLENOID ASSEMBLY in place. Since OCCASIONAL INSPECTION AND CLEANING is desirable, be sure to add the valves to your scheduled maintenance program. Flowing media and cycle rate will determine the desired interval between inspections. Removing the BONNET exposes the internal parts of the valve. It is not necessary to remove the VALVE BODY from the line for inspection or repairs. Valve parts may be cleaned in commercial products such as Lime-Away® or CLR™ to remove mineral deposits. Be sure any cleaning solution is compatible with BOTH the metallic and non-metallic (seats & seals) components. Parts should be rinsed thoroughly in clean running water before re-assembly.
